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ments. Based on the embodiments in the present invention, all other embodiments obtained by a person skilled in the art without creative work belong to the protection scope of the present invention.
Referring to fig. 1-3, the utility model provides an information security monitoring system, which comprises a top plate 1 and a monitor 5, wherein the top of the monitor 5 is provided with an electric connecting rod 3, the top of the connecting rod 3 is fixed with a top seat 4, the top of the top seat 4 is provided with an electric rotating disc 2, and the electric rotating disc 2 is arranged at the bottom of the top plate 1;
a hinge block 11 is fixed at the top of the monitor 5, a hinge hole 12 is formed in one side of the hinge block 11, a groove 9 matched with the hinge block 11 is installed at the bottom of the electric connecting rod 3, and electric rotating rods 10 are rotatably installed on the two side arms of the groove 9; and the hinge block 11 is rotatably connected with the electric rotating rod 10 through a hinge hole 12 at one side.
The bottom of the electric rotating disc 2 is provided with a circular groove matched with the top seat 4, the electric top seat 4 is clamped inside the circular groove at the bottom of the electric rotating disc 2, and the electric rotating disc 2 drives the electric connecting rod 3 to rotate through the top seat 4;
as an optimal technical solution of the utility model: a smoke alarm 6 is fixed on the rear side of the monitor 5, a buzzer alarm 13 is fixed on one side of the top of the monitor 5, the smoke alarm 6 is in one-way electric connection with the buzzer alarm 13 through a power line, when a fire or smoke occurs indoors, the smoke alarm 6 can receive information and transmit the information to the buzzer alarm 13 through the power line, other personnel are warned through the buzzer alarm 13, and the fireproof safety of the monitoring system is improved;
as an optimal technical solution of the utility model: a plurality of shoulder holes 7 have been seted up to the diapire of electronic rolling disc 2 the form that is annular array, and the bolt 8 of looks adaptation is all installed to the inside of a plurality of shoulder holes 7, and a plurality of screw holes that have with shoulder hole 7 looks adaptation are seted up to the bottom of roof 1, and a plurality of bolts 8 carry out threaded connection through the shoulder hole 7 of the 2 diapalls of equal electronic rolling disc and the screw hole of the 1 diapalls of roof, can guarantee that roof 1 and electronic rolling disc 3 dismantle.
As an optimal technical solution of the utility model: the maximum clockwise rotation angle of the electric rotation rod 10 of the inner side arm of the groove 9 is 30 degrees, and the maximum counterclockwise rotation angle of the electric rotation rod 10 of the inner side arm of the groove 9 is 30 degrees.
The working principle of the embodiment is as follows: when the information safety monitoring system is used, as shown in fig. 1-3, the monitor 5 can be driven to rotate by matching the groove at the bottom of the electric rotating disc 2 with the top seat 4 and the electric connecting rod 3, the electric rotating rod 10 at the inner side of the groove 9 drives the hinged block 11 to rotate again, the monitor 5 is driven to slightly rotate up and down by the hinged block 11, when a fire or smoke occurs indoors, the smoke alarm 6 can receive information, and the smoke alarm 6 transmits the information to the buzzer alarm 13 through a power line to warn other people.
